Best Laptop for Developers 2020

Whether it’s web development or game development, there is no doubt that developers need a powerful laptop that can keep up with their needs.

There are a lot of factors to choose from when deciding on the best laptop for developers. The range of factors is mainly due to the wide variety of software a developer might be asked to work on. However, at the end of the day, all developers need a reliable laptop that can deliver power and performance.

We asked around and did our research before coming up with our top five picks for the best developer laptops in the market.

ASUS ZenBook Pro UX501VW-US71 15.6-Inch...
  • 15.6" Touch IPS 4K Ultra­-HD display, 3840 x 2160 resolution
  • Powerful Intel Skylake Core i7­-6700HQ 2.6 GHz Quad­core CPU (turbo to...
  • 512GB SSD with transfer speeds of 1400MB/s and 16GB DDR4 RAM

How we chose the best laptop for developers

With all the different kinds of developers out there, we really had our job cut out for us in researching the biggest factors that come into play when a developer chooses their laptop. As we delved deeper into our research, we found that there are some core features that all developers look for when selecting their laptop.

We also found that many of the considerations that a developer looks for in a laptop overlap with considerations when choosing a great programming laptop.

Based on our data, we managed to filter down the considerations to the top five features.

  • Hard Drive
  • CPU & Memory
  • Screen Size & Resolution
  • Graphics Card
  • Portability
  • The five best laptop for developers

    The most important consideration when choosing the best laptop for developers

    When working on programs such as AutoCAD or visual content, developers often find themselves working on very large files. Due to this, it is essential for developer laptops to have enough hard drive capacity to fulfil their file requirements.

    There have been huge advances in hard drives over the past couple of decades. This means that in traditional Hard Disk Drive (HDD) storage, we see no reason why a developer should settle for anything less than 1 TB when considering a new laptop.

    There is also Solid State Drive (SSD) storage to consider. SSD hard drives provide an amazing boost in speed and loading times. Despite its price, it is hard to turn away from the lure of a hard drive that promises to boost the overall performance and run time of a program.

    At the very least, we recommend a Hybrid drive that combines the capacity of HDD while also providing a boost in speed by throwing in some SSD into the mix.

    Other considerations when choosing the best laptop for developers

    CPU & Memory

    Any developer laptop should have sufficient processing power and memory to keep up with their work demands.

    Ideally, a developer laptop should run on Intel Core i7. It is also possible to work well with an Intel Core i5 as a processor, especially if developing software that doesn’t require as much intense computer processing, such as web or mobile app development.

    For the memory requirement, the best set-up would be a laptop that is outfitted with 16 GB DDR4 RAM. But anything above 8 GB DDR3 RAM is just as likely to get the job done. A laptop with less than 8 GB RAM might prove troublesome and laggy for a developer in the long run.

    Screen Size & Resolution

    Developers spend their entire day staring at their laptop’s screens. Sometimes they are staring at line after line of programming code; other times they are working on very graphic-intensive renderings. Yet other developers spend much of their time traveling for SysAdmin or Network Administration and require a laptop that is immensely portable.

    Whatever the case may be, it is necessary for their laptop to have proper screen size and resolution to alleviate eye fatigue as much as possible. For our top five picks, our selection of laptops range between 13.5” to 17.3”.

    Depending on the developer’s lifestyle, work requirements, and need for portability, the general rule-of-thumb is that a laptop screen should be as wide as the job and convenience allows.

    Graphics Card

    Some developers are required to work on programs that are very reliant on the graphics, such as animation, 3D modelling or game development. A good dedicated graphics card is an essential element for these developers.

    An integrated graphics card should come with a bare minimum of 2 GB dedicated video memory to meet the minimum requirements when coding video games or working in 3D.


    The final consideration when selecting the best developer laptop is portability. Some developer jobs, such as SysAdmins, can involve a lot of travelling. These developers find portability to be an extremely important factor when choosing a laptop.

    Portability, for this set of developers, does not just look at the size and weight of a laptop, but the battery life as well. They require a laptop that is compact yet powerful. Their laptops should be able to withstand extended periods without being near an electrical socket as they never know what they will find at each job.

    The best laptop for developers

    Asus Zenbook Pro UX501VW - Best Laptop for DevelopersAfter making our comparisons and comparing them with our metrics for best developer laptop, we finally managed to choose our top five picks. From that top five, our #1 Pick, winning by a narrow margin, is the ASUS ZenBook Pro UX501VW.

    ASUS has packed their ZenBook Pro with some excellent hardware. The ZenBook Pro features a quad-core 2.6 GHz Intel Core i7-6700HQ processor with 16 GB DDR4 RAM. ASUS’s ZenBook Pro also comes with 512 GB SSD hard drive, promising fast loading times and transfer speeds. All these components come together to provide developers with a powerful laptop that can run any program smoothly all the time.

    For its graphics card, the ASUS ZenBook Pro comes with an NVIDIA GeForce GTX 960M with 2 GB dedicated memory. This laptop can easily handle any number of graphics-heavy professional applications. The laptop also has an excellent cooling system so developers can work the laptop hard at its peak performance and not worry about the system overheating.

    The ZenBook’s all-aluminum chassis gives a sleek design that houses a 15.6” touch screen with 4K Ultra HD. There is an amazing 3840 x 2160 resolution on this laptop, giving sharp and bright visuals regardless of whether the developer is looking at 3D models or lines of code.

    At 5 pounds, this laptop is slightly heavier than some other 15” laptops; however, it more than makes up for the slight heft by offering an impressive battery life of up to 8 hours. The laptop also comes with great connectivity, including a USB-C port with Thunderbolt 3.

    Asus Zenbook Pro UX501VW Keyboard Shot - Best Laptop for Developers

    The four other laptops for developers we tested

    MSI WT72 6QI-654US

    MSI WT72 LaptopAnother fantastic laptop for developers is the MSI WT72 6QI-654US7.

    The MSI WT72 offers users a powerful high-performance laptop, but at the cost of battery life and weight. The WT72 comes with a quad-core 2.6 GHz Intel Core i7-6700HQ processor and 16 GB DDR4 memory. Its 1 TB 7200 RPM HDD with 128 SSD storage allows programs to load and run faster.

    In addition, its NVIDIA Quadro M1000M 3D graphics card comes with 2 GB dedicated memory. The WT72, being the professional line from a manufacturer that specializes in gaming laptops, you can be sure the laptop has a well-designed cooling system to handle a maximum workload all day long.

    It’s 17.3” screen has a resolution of 1920 x 1080 pixels. However, the size also contributes to its hefty weight of 8.4 pounds. Its battery life is also pretty short, lasting only about 2 to 3 hours.

    Developers who are looking for a laptop that packs power, peak performance, and large screen size should certainly take a closer look at the MSI WT72.

    Dell Inspiron i7559-2512BLK

    Dell Inspiron i7559 LaptopThe Dell Inspiron i7559-2512BLK is a great laptop where performance meets mobility meets affordability.

    The i7559 houses a 6th-generation 2.6 GHz Intel Core i7 processor as well as 8 GB DDR3L RAM. It utilizes a Hybrid hard drive with 1 TB HDD and an additional 8 GB SSD.

    The Inspiron i7559 comes with an NVIDIA GeForce GTX 960M with 4 GB discrete memory. Two cooling fans, three exhausts and large vents with 240 thermal fins all work hard to keep the laptop cool at all times, even while rendering 3D models or developing new games.

    Dell’s Inspiron i7559 is 15.6” and features full HD with 1920 x 1080 resolution. It weighs in at just 4.6 pounds and has 7 to 10 hours of battery life.

    The Dell Inspiron i7559 is a great choice for developers who are in the market for an affordable developer laptop that also offers great performance and mobility.

    Lenovo Z70

    Lenovo Z70The Lenovo Z70 is a wonderful laptop for those looking for something that gives portability without sacrificing screen size.

    Running on a 5th-generation 2.4 GHz Intel Core i7 processor with 8 GB DDR3L memory, Lenovo’s Z70 comes with a Hybrid hard drive of 1 TB 5400 RPM HDD with 8 GB NAND Flash memory. It also has an NVIDIA GeForce 840M graphics card with 2 GB dedicated video memory.

    The laptop has a 17.3” screen, offering FHD in 1920 x 1080 resolution. Its battery can run up to 5 hours and it weighs 6.61 pounds, which is light given its 17.3” screen.

    As a desktop replacement laptop for developers, the Z70 manages to merge the performance and comfort of desktops with the mobility of laptops.

    Microsoft Surface Book

    Microsoft Surface BookThe Microsoft Surface Book is the ultimate laptop when it comes to mobility. However, it also comes at a pretty expensive price, especially after the required hardware is added for the peak performance that developers need for their jobs.

    The Surface Book that comes with the best components includes an Intel Core i7 processor and 16 GB RAM. In addition to that, developers can opt for up to 1 TB Flash Memory and an NVIDIA graphics card. As expected, all these components add up to an extremely impressive and light laptop with great all-round performance.

    The Surface Book has a screen size of 13.5” but features a resolution of 3000 x 2000. The screen is a touch screen and Microsoft’s Surface Book comes with a stylus as well. A key feature of the Surface Book is its ability to transform from laptop to tablet simply by pulling its screen apart from its keyboard.

    The Surface Book weighs just 3.34 pounds and has a truly amazing battery life lasting up to 12 hours in laptop mode. Its tablet mode battery life is only able to last about 2 to 3 hours, but developers might prefer to work in laptop mode as the graphics card is located in the keyboard.

    If price is not an issue, the Microsoft Surface Book is definitely a laptop that can offer flexibility and peak performance to a developer.

    The bottom line

    While the ASUS ZenBook Pro UX501VW offered the best combination of affordable performance, we also found many other laptops to suit a developer’s needs depending on whether they are more keyed toward mobility, performance or affordability.

    Finding the best developer laptop depends greatly on the type of work the developer does. Whether they need maximum performance for working on AutoCAD or rendering 3D models, mobility for Network Administration, or sharp screens for reading code and managing databases, our top five picks is sure to have something for every developer.

    The Microsoft Surface Book is extremely light for those who travel a lot. The Lenovo Z70 and MSI WT72 offer 17” screens for developers that prefer wider views. The Dell Inspiron is an affordable developer laptop that does not skimp on performance. However, it was the ASUS ZenBook Pro UX501VW that offered the best of all worlds with decent screen size, performance components, and great mobility and battery life.

    ASUS ZenBook Pro UX501VW-US71 15.6-Inch...
    • 15.6" Touch IPS 4K Ultra­-HD display, 3840 x 2160 resolution
    • Powerful Intel Skylake Core i7­-6700HQ 2.6 GHz Quad­core CPU (turbo to...
    • 512GB SSD with transfer speeds of 1400MB/s and 16GB DDR4 RAM
    Best Laptop for Developers
    • ASUS ZenBook Pro UX501VW
    • MSI WT72 6QI-654US
    • Dell Inspiron i7559-2512BLK
    • Lenovo Z70
    • Microsoft Surface Book


    We selected the best laptop for developers after doing research on a number of different laptops that suit the needs of a developer.

    Leave a Reply